a software great too - all the galaxies were generated by algorithm rather than explicit data or else it would not have fit.

Docking:

Fly at station, stop, fly towards planet, turn round fly back to station you will be right in front of it. Wait for the slot to become horizontal and hit the throttle. So simple it's nothing at all.

For those who got stuck at Deadly on original Elite, you needed to do the Constrictor special mission. This wasn't on the BBC tape version. I also remember having to type in thousands of lines of code to get Military Lasers via a save editor, and deducted the cost from my money as cheating was for suckers.
